DragonTHON at Drexel University, recipient of the 2025 Excellence in National Program Engagement Award
Miracle Network Dance Marathon recognized top-performing Dance Marathon programs at Children’s Miracle Network Hospitals’ Ignite: Peer-to-Peer Leadership Conference held in Kansas City, MO, from July 17-20, 2025.
The Excellence in National Program Engagement Award honors a program that actively connects with the broader network and applies national strategies to strengthen its efforts on campus. Through engagement with initiatives like 1 More in ‘24, intentional onboarding, and participation in Children’s Miracle Network Hospitals’ Ignite: Peer-to-Peer Leadership Conference, this year’s winner showed what it looks like to stay aligned with national priorities while adapting them to their unique community.

DragonTHON consistently looked to the larger network to inform and inspire their work. They attended and presented at Ignite, offering their own experiences to help other programs grow. They took full advantage of the fall and spring incentives, using those activations to increase participant engagement through targeted outreach, team captain education, and social media efforts.
During the 1 More in ‘24 campaign, DragonTHON encouraged their participants to complete daily actions and stay connected to the campaign’s goals. They also maintained regular communication with their Campus Programs Manager, seeking feedback and applying best practices that helped drive consistent improvement throughout the year.
